About the role

Join our team as Chief Nuclear Medicine Technologist and lead the delivery of Nuclear Medicine and Imaging services across TQEH and LMH. You will provide expert leadership, oversee service provision and ensure high quality, safe and efficient imaging and therapy outcomes.

Working as a senior technologist, you will coordinate daily workflow, develop and maintain procedures and standards, and oversee complex radiopharmacy and laboratory practices. You will drive continuous quality improvement, contribute to policy, research and education, and respond to changing service demands while representing the service in key meetings and supporting strong clinical performance.

About us

Statewide Clinical Support Services (SCSS) is a unique public healthcare organisation that serves health consumers and provides specialist clinical services to the health system in South Australia. SCSS encompasses BreastScreen SA, SA Dental, SA Medical Imaging, SA Pathology, and SA Pharmacy.
